ABSTRACT:
According to one embodiment, a portable electronic apparatus includes a housing having a first surface, an antenna provided in the housing, and a close proximity wireless transfer device provided in the housing and configured to execute, via the first surface, close proximity wireless transfer with an external device which is present within a predetermined wireless communication-capable distance from the antenna. The antenna is provided on an inner side in the first surface, with a space greater than the wireless communication-capable distance being provided from an outer peripheral edge of the first surface.
